Just reread Kerry's comments re: Mary Cheney. WHAT'S THE BIG F'ING DEAL?
Edited on Thu Oct-14-04 09:39 AM by MallRat
KERRY: We're all God's children, Bob. And I think if you were to talk to Dick Cheney's daughter, who is a lesbian, she would tell you that she's being who she was, she's being who she was born as.

That's it. No backhanded swipes at the Vice-President or Bush. No gratuitous slam of White House policy. Nada.

It is clearer to me now, more than ever, that the Republicans are DESPERATELY trying to make an issue out of nothing.
